Can you imagine what planet Earth will be like in 1500 years? And what would happen if one day you accidentally traveled to the future? Well that is just what has happened to Nico, the protagonist of this adventure.
Nico is a normal and ordinary child, or rather, he would be if it were not for he is the son of a crazy inventor; Creator, among other inventions, of the atomic sandwich makers, the automatic "ear-scratchers" and of Peludo, Nico's ever faithful robot dog.
Due to a "mistake" in one of their father's latest inventions, Nico and Furry will end up traveling hundreds of years into the future and will find a planet Earth quite different from the one we all know today: a planet Earth full of spaceships, huge buildings connected by tube-lifts and full of fantastic robots that will try to help Nico go back to his time. But that will not be an easy task ...
CMY Multimedia was a spanish video game development studio based in Villaviciosa de Odón, Madrid, founded in 2000. Closed in 2008.
As a development studio it has developed a total of 22 spanish videogames, being some of the most importantn Xiro y la Ciudad Sumergida (CMY Multimedia, 2005) o Aymun: Aprendiz de Pirata (CMY Multimedia, 2005). They have also developed other video games such as Olimpiadas del Saber (CMY Multimedia, 2008), 20.000 Leguas de Viaje Submarino (CMY Multimedia, 2007), and Nico en el Planeta Robot (CMY Multimedia, 2007).
